Red Hunger

When the sexy trucker he's fantasized about turns out to be a CIA assassin-and a vampire-whose team needs his help to bring down a drug dealer, bartender Vince West lets go of inhibitions he's harbored too long and admits his sexuality, allowing himself the freedom to share his bed with Jas. But in agreeing to help the Night Squad, Vince gives up his dreams of returning to San Francisco. He knows he probably won't survive the sting, whether it's the drug dealers who get him.or the vampires.

Jas Tudor and his team need Vince to lead them to a drug kingpin, but Jas' interest in the handsome bartender with the ultra-sweet blood goes deeper. He lures Vince out of his protective shell and enjoys taking him to unimaginable heights of pleasure, even as Jas counts his regrets. His team is swift and destructive, and rarely leaves behind survivors. If Vince doesn't end up as collateral damage, the vampires will mind-wipe him when the operation concludes, destroying his memories of their magical time together.

Comes the Wolf

Heiress Madeline Randall Forsythe is on the run for her very life, hiding in a small Washington town as "Randie." Fleeing a deadly family secret, she plans to move on every couple of months to stay alive. But the night she’s due to leave Silver Creek, a blizzard, a crunched fender and a rescue by a handsome stranger complicate her escape. While she knows relationships are impossible for a fugitive, she seizes her own destiny and lets Aidan rock her world, even as she knows the closer she gets to strangers, the more chances she has of getting caught.

Tracker Aidan Chase has been hired to find the missing heiress, and the two hundred and fifty thousand dollars she stole from her father. His werewolf senses make him an ace at his craft and he's never failed to find a target. But from the start this proves to be no ordinary case, and when he locates “Randie” Forsythe in a small mountain town, an old enemy complicates the job almost as much as the sexy heiress does herself. Aidan must make a choice: obey his own rule to never get involved, or follow his gut instinct and protect the woman he senses is his heart mate.

Alpha Heat

When Commander Jace Weston of the Universal Guard tracks a fugitive into the harem of a royal palace, he never expects to find an ally--and a lover--in the nubile princess of the rival kingdom. Forbidden to marry or even dally while on duty, Jace doesn’t dream about things he can never have. But when he meets the courageous princess condemned to a loveless marriage who dreams of nothing but finding love, he learns some things are worth wishing for.

Political climates change like the direction of the wind, and Princess Tamara understands someday she will have to marry the unpleasant prince of her neighboring kingdom. But when she is rescued from a grotesque alien fugitive by a drop-dead sexy soldier, Tamara seizes the opportunity to choose her first lover. The three-day journey back to her kingdom filled with scorching sex turns into more than just astounding physical delight, and Tamara fears she cannot live without the touch of the strong soldier who has stolen her heart.

Wild At Heart

What is more passionate than forbidden love?

Penny Thompson’s impending marriage to a prissy easterner she’s never met signifies the end of her idyllic freedom. A tomboy at heart, she’d rather work her family’s cattle ranch from the back of a horse than bake and sew. The thought of marrying a man she doesn’t know is bad enough, but when she meets a half-breed Indian who ignites her desire, the idea of a wedding night with a stranger she doesn’t love turns abhorrent. John Black Feather’s touch causes a storm of passion Penny fears she cannot live without.

The son of a Navajo chief and a white captive, John Black Feather has always walked between two worlds. Conceived and educated specifically to help the tribe’s relations with the spreading white world, his dalliance with Penny Thompson could ruin his father’s decades-old plan. But Penny enflames him and drives him to take foolish risks for their love…even though he knows a future with her is impossible.

Claiming Lady Marianne
Length: Novella
 
After Marianne is caught en compromise with another woman, her husband, the vicious Viscount Cobham, is enraged. He remands Marianne to the care of her beastly grandfather with orders that she take a lover—a male lover. She is to get herself with child by the time he returns from his travels in six months. He will have his heir, one way or another. Marianne’s grandfather charges his stable master with the task, and Marianne is bound to her bed every third night to await the burly man.
 
Michael Ainsworth is no stud horse, and Baron Thurlow’s task is too ghastly to consider. But Michael longs for a glimpse of the pretty girl who used to cling to the paddock fence to watch the horses. When he finds her terrified and unwilling, his honor demands he protect her—despite the heartbreaking knowledge the viscountess can never love a lowly servant.

The Clash
Genre: Vampire Paranormal/Urban Fantasy
Length:Novel
 
Cvetelina Maldonova knows Agent Almaden wouldn’t have come all the way to Romania to ask for her help if he wasn’t forced to--he can’t stand her undead guts. He’s the most pigheaded human she’s ever met. And having lived for six hundred years, she’s met a lot. Not only does Robert believe he can cure his son of vampirism, he won’t listen when she tries to tell him an assassin has him targeted. He’s going to get his fool neck bit, and Cvetelina knows she’ll be blamed if he returns to his agency in a coffin. Whether he likes it or not, she’s sticking to him like glue. At least he’s easy on the eyes, and when Cvetelina looks into his cool blue ones, she can almost see daylight again. 
 
But when he’s dosed with Tourin and goes mad with sexual need, that’s the last straw. She grabs the nearest thing she can find to restrain him; the sex-ties in her bedroom. Suddenly Robert is bound and helpless, and things are looking more interesting. What to do, what to do...

The Collision

Genre: Vampire Paranormal Ménage

Previous Book: The Combat

Balin Renforth has served the Guardians loyally for six hundred years, protecting innocents from vampire scum like Fitch Galloway. But he cannot deny the nagging familiarity Fitch inspires, any more than he can deny the irresistible curiosity stirred by the other man.

Fitch Galloway recognizes Balin immediately, though he never knew of the man’s ties to the magical Ancient Fae which gave him the powers he used to transport them to the outer limits. The Guardian has clearly grown a stick up his ass, yet Fitch cannot deny that saving him more than six hundred years ago was the best thing he ever did, and Balin has become an honorable man he cannot help but feel proud of. But that's not the only feeling the handsome Guardian stirs in Fitch...

The Combat

Genre: Shape-shifter/Vampire Urban Fantasy Paranormal
Length: Novel

Amidst a cataclysmic war between the Guardians, an ancient sect of gargoyles charged with policing vampirekind, and a maniacal vampire king who intends to enslave humanity for the sinful pleasures of vampires worldwide...

Desperate to locate her missing sister, Gabrielle Langston travels to San Francisco expecting to find Linna in a fanatical Goth community of wannabe blood suckers. Instead Gabrielle discovers real--real!--vampires, sexy gargoyles, and an undead prince intent on claiming her as his bride.

Though it's been over eight hundred years since a vampire killed his young wife, the scars on Davin McCain’s soul still burn deep. He has risked his life for the Guardians for eight centuries, yet never again has he risked his heart. But when he rescues feisty Gabrielle, drugged by the vampires to make her insatiable, Davin is lost to the charms of the pretty, green-eyed human.

Gabrielle's dangerous idea to infiltrate the vampire coven is the only chance the Guardians have to finally locate the vampire’s “Palace,” but Davin realizes while he’s just found the mate he wants by his side for eternity, he could lose her in mere days.
